How to make a Champion. Chris Pilone. 03.11.2021

Pilone knows - he took Hamish Carter from disaster at the Sydney Olympics to Gold in Athens. Here the back story of how important a coach is to the top talent. He talks the importance of chemistry between coach and athlete, and has a crack at solving centralised high performance. A great listen. Thanks, Pilone.

What makes a champion? Sam Warriner. 15.10.2021

What makes a champion? Sam Warriner joins the podcast as we ask a deep and meaningful question - what makes a champion? Rather than focus on her greatest races, we go right back - from primary school to today and look for clues. With Sam, we reveal how she made it to the top.  It’s a great listen.
